    Sail maker Henry Skey Purnell was apprentice to sail making with Richard V erity and served for 7 years from 17 July 1855 (aged 17). His pay ranged f rom 3 shillings per week in the first year to 10 shillings a week in t he 7 year. He went to school at Bath and College Green, Bristol.

    Discharge reference Araby Maid:
    This is to certify that Henry Purnell has served on board the ship Araby M aid as sail maker on a voyage from Cardiff to China and back to Hamburg. D uring this time he has conducted himself to my satisfaction so that i ha ve pleasure in recommending to any ships master who may require his servic es
    Hamburg
    January 9th 1872 K. Butler
    Master
    The Araby Maid was a three masted schooner. Sunk in a collision in 1903, s he now rests in approximately 200' of water near the Dry Tortugas. Sitti ng upright, the large composite vessel is amazingly intact. The damage cau sed by the collision is easily identified near the bow on the portside. T he lower decks are still intact, her wooden planking still sound. Her mas ts lie off on the sides, as well as other unidentified parts of wreckag e. The stern of the Araby Maid is still intact, rising high off the bott om with her rudder easily visible. Numerous portholes were recovered, lyi ng loose on the deck. Her bronze capstan cover and bell were also recovere d, helping to identify the previously unknown vessel

    Ship details from Ben Line Fleet List
    Entered Ben Line Service 1868
    Ended Ben Line Service 1894
    Year sunk 1903
    Gross Tonnage 863
    Net Tonnage 837
    Length 195
    Beam 32
    Depth 19
    1868 - completed by R. Steele & Co., Greenock Yard No. 66
    1894 - sold to Aktieselskabet, Norway. Name unchanged
    1903 - sank after collision with S.S. DENVER off Florida, while on passa ge from Mobile to Rosario with pitch pine.
    The Araby Maid, official number 62272, was built in October 1868 by Robe rt Steele and Company of Greenock. An elegant bark, she was 194.6 fe et in length, 32 feet in beam, and displaced 863 tons.


    Discharge Reference Falkland Bank:
    I hereby certify that Henry Purnell has served with me on board the ship F alkland Bank as sail maker on a voyage to South America and Sydney and fin ally return in this past time for 18 months and I can verify he is an exce llent seaman in every aspect.
    J.A. Robbins
    Master
    Ship Falkland Bank
    Liverpool
    Febuary 14th 1901

    Dadicated by Capt: J.A.Robbins to the Officers and Crew of ship Falkla nd Bank
    In memory of carrying the first Original Cargo of Argentina Wheat around t he world and 8,000 miles over the distance.
